VirtualBox下Android-x86安装与基础配置
虚拟机:Virtual Box 6.1
系统:android-x86_64-8.1-r6
一、下载 Android x86 镜像
英文站 Android on x86 项目
中文站 安卓X86中文站
二、虚拟机配置
1.新建虚拟机,类型:“Linux”,版本:“Linux 2.6 / 3.x / 4.x (64-bit)”,内存大小:大于2GB
2.“设置 -> 系统 -> 处理器”,添加更多的处理器核心
3.“设置 -> 显示 -> 显存大小” ,开启 3D 加速功能
三、安装Android
1.首次启动虚拟机,选择之前下载好的Android 镜像
2.选择 “Installation” 选项(方向键选择,回车确认)
3.选择“创建/修改分区”
4.官方不推荐使用 GPT 格式,所以我们选择 “No”
5.在cfdisk页面,创建分区,使用方向键来选择 “New” ,然后选择 “Primary”,按回车键以确认
6.关于分区大小,回车键确认
7.选择 “Bootable”,然后按回车键(上方表格中 “Flags” 标志下面会出现 “boot” 标志),选择 “Write” 选项,输入“yes”保存刚才的操作记录并写入分区表
8.选择“Quit”退出分区工具,继续安装过程
9.选择刚刚创建的分区,选择“OK”
10.分区格式选择 Ext4
11.选择“yes”,GRUB选择“yes”,/system读写选择 “Yes”
12.安装完成,可选择Reboot重启。
13*.选择重启后,还会加载系统安装界面,因为没有移除虚拟盘。移除后,点击“控制 -> 重启”
四、运行Android
1.进入GRUB引导界面,选择默认选项
2.启动成功,显示如下界面 (若启动失败,继续往下看)
3*.若启动失败,显示黑屏,解决方法如下:
(1)点击“控制 -> 重启”,进入GRUB引导界面,选择第二项
(2)在所有信息刷完后,按下回车
输入mount –o remount,rw /mnt 回车(rw 后有一个空格,注意)
出现下图,说明正确,继续下一条指令
(3)再输入vi /mnt/grub/menu.lst 回车(vi后面有一个空格)出现下图:
(4)按下 i 键,变为可编辑状态,移动光标,将上图的红线处修改为 nomodeset_root ,如下图:
(5)按esc 退出编辑,输入 :wq 保存并退出
(6)重启
4.进入设置向导,选择简体中文,(可顺时针依次点击屏幕四角跳过向导,如下图):
5.进入桌面
五*、网络配置
注:以下内容我个人测试可行,并不保证通用。
1.安装好的Android x86目前是无法上网的,首先将虚拟机网络设置为“桥接网卡”
2.打开终端模拟器,输入 su 回车,进入超级管理员模式
3.输入 vi /etc/init.sh 回车(vi后面有一个空格),进入如下界面
4.按下 i 键,变为可编辑状态,移动光标,在上图箭头所指位置,输入 setprop net.dns1 8.8.8.8 如图所示
5.按esc 退出编辑,输入 :wq 保存并退出
6.打开右上角WiFi开关,连接VirtWifi
7.回到终端,输入 ping www.baidu.com 测试公网,若显示如下图,则可成功上网
VirtualBox下Android-x86安装与基础配置相关推荐
- linux7开放svn,CentOS 7 下SVN的安装及基础配置介绍
CentOS 7 下SVN的安装及基础配置介绍 一.实践环境 二.安装操作系统 三.安装SVN 四.基础配置 五.启动SVN 六.客户端访问 七.常见问题排查 一.实践环境 CentOS 7操作系统( ...
- SVN CentOS7 下配置svn的安装及基础配置介绍
CentOS7 下配置svn的安装及基础配置介绍 by:授客 QQ:1033553122 目录 一. 实践环境... 1 二. 安装操作系统... 1 三. ...
- Android 开发之Windows环境下Android Studio安装和使用教程(图文详细步骤)
鉴于谷歌最新推出的Android Studio备受开发者的推崇,所以也跟着体验一下. 一.介绍Android Studio Android Studio 是一个Android开发环境,基于Intel ...
- virtualbox android分辨率,VirtualBox 修改Android x86虚拟机的分辨率
VirtualBox 修改Android x86虚拟机的分辨率 首先说明一下,本人使用的是Windows下的VirtualBox,android x86使用的是9.0-r2版本一.查看virtualb ...
- Windows下Android开发环境搭建和配置
关于Windows下Android开发环境搭建.配置方面文章,网上一搜一堆,为方便以后参考,权且做个记录,主要关注安装过程中的注意事项.对新手提醒的是,本文介绍SDK开发Android APK环境搭建 ...
- macos下使用aria2_macOS下 ansible简单安装及基础使用
macOS下 ansible简单安装及基础使用,其实命令是相通的,我这篇测试基本都是在macOS下执行的.在Linux操作系统下几乎同样的办法. ansible是一种自动化运维工具,基于Python开 ...
- win8系统安装配置python_win8下python3.4安装和环境配置图文教程
win8下python安装和环境配置,具体内容如下 python语法较C语言简单,容易上手. 具体步骤 1.本文采用的是win8.1 64位系统,安装python3.4. 2.先在python官网上下 ...
- proxmox ve 中文社区_基于ProXmoX VE的虚拟化家庭服务器(篇一)—ProXmoX VE 安装及基础配置...
基于ProXmoX VE的虚拟化家庭服务器(篇一)-ProXmoX VE 安装及基础配置 2018-09-22 16:00:09 246点赞 2066收藏 327评论 你是AMD Yes党?还是int ...
- Katalon Studio自动化测试框架使用【1】--- 环境安装以及基础配置(MacOS)
一.Katalon Studio简介 Katalon Studio是一款免费的自动化测试工具,可以安装在windows.macOS.Linux操作系统上,结合了selenium和appium测试框架, ...
- windows10系统下MongoDB的安装及环境配置
windows10系统下MongoDB的安装及环境配置: MongoDB的安装 下载地址: https://www.mongodb.com/download-center (这是windows10环境 ...
最新文章
- 机器视觉+常识+概念
- Spring in Action 4 读书笔记之使用标签创建 AOP
- 轻量级DAO层实践初体验
- com.android.dex.DexIndexOverflowException: Cannot merge new index 66299 into a non-jumbo instruction
- 关于一道数据库例题的解析。为什么σ age22 (πS_ID,SCORE (SC) ) 选项是错的?
- 线性表的定义与操作-顺序表,链式表(C语言)
- Behavior Designer
- css修改span位置_简历完善,CSS布局与定位,笔记
- 论文阅读:BPFINet: Boundary-aware progressive feature integration network for salient object detection
- spring读取jdbc(file方式)
- 截止2021年7月中国有多少大学生?
- win7系统安装VS 2019
- Linux中禁用USB驱动存储
- WINDOWS图像编程
- 骑士游历问题(C语言代码)
- 将十六进制数的ASCII码转换为十进制数。十六进制数的值域为0~65535,最大转换为五位十进制数。要求将缓冲区的000CH的ASCII码转换为十进制,并将结果显示在屏幕上。
- excel 将A列相同的值对应的B列的单元格进行合并,并保留单元格内容
- PC与手机通过有线或无线共享文件或网络
- c语言打字母游戏源码
- 读书笔记-建立自己的声望